  • Title

    Wavelength modulation off-axis integrated cavity output spectroscopy for biogenic NO detection in human breath

  • Abstract
    A compact gas sensor based on a CW mid-infrared tunable quantum cascade laser and wavelength modulation off-axis integrated cavity output spectroscopy has been developed to measure biogenic NO concentrations in human breath.
